WebJan 19, 2024 · Cod worms are found in cod, haddock, pollock, and hake. 5 They are easily visible to the naked eye and are easily removed if you catch them. Good New England fish houses "candle" their fish by putting the fillets on a lightbox to detect the worms. This is why cod is never seen at a sushi bar. WebShellfish includes prawns, mussels, scallops, squid and langoustine. Shellfish are: low in fat; a source of selenium, zinc, iodine and copper; Some types of shellfish, such as mussels, oysters, squid and crab, are also good sources of long-chain omega-3 fatty acids, but they do not contain as much as oily fish.
